问题描述
如何在asp.net中直接给gridview控件赋固定的值,也就是说,不用数据库里的数据,而是自己手动给它赋值。
解决方案
解决方案二:
解决方案三:
自己对DataTable填充,然后绑定到dataview
解决方案四:
示例DataTabledt=newDataTable();dt.Columns.Add("学号",typeof(string));dt.Columns.Add("姓名",typeof(string));dt.Columns.Add("年龄",typeof(int));dt.Rows.Add("12345","张三",20);dt.Rows.Add("13579","李四",18);GridView1.DataSource=dt;GridView1.DataBind();
解决方案五:
做测试?前台:<%@PageLanguage="C#"AutoEventWireup="true"CodeBehind="WebForm1.aspx.cs"Inherits="LINQWeb.WebForm1"%><!DOCTYPEhtmlPUBLIC"-//W3C//DTDXHTML1.0Transitional//EN""http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><htmlxmlns="http://www.w3.org/1999/xhtml"><headrunat="server"><title></title></head><body><formid="form1"runat="server"><div><asp:GridViewrunat="server"ID="TestGridView"></asp:GridView></div></form></body></html>
后台:protectedvoidPage_Load(objectsender,EventArgse){DataTabledt=newDataTable();dt.Columns.Add("V1");dt.Columns.Add("V2");DataRowdr=dt.NewRow();dr["V1"]="Test1";dr["V2"]="Test2";dt.Rows.Add(dr);this.TestGridView.DataSource=dt;this.TestGridView.DataBind();}